Qualified teacher status (QTS) is a legal requirement to teach in many English schools and considered desirable for teachers in the majority of schools in England.
Schools in England where teachers can be employed without QTS include academies, free schools and private schools.

Your Workforce Census summary shows 'Number of staff records with no QTS indicator' in table B: Missing staff details.
How to Resolve
- Check for a staff member with the Post held of Support Staff (SUP) in their contract - this is an old post type and no longer in use, so will need changing to 'Teaching Assistant' or 'Other Support Staff' as appropriate.
- To check this you can go to Admin > Personnel > Staff Group Updater
- For the Staff Attribute, type in 'Post' then select it from the list and click Choose
*You may also wish to include inactive staff contracts by ticking the 'Include inactive staff' box
- A table of results will be displayed, showing what post staff members currently have in their contracts. If any have 'SUP' they need updating.
- To update, select the staff member you wish to change, then from the drop down box at the top of the table select which post you want to change them to.
- Click 'Update Staff' at the bottom to save.
- You could also run the staff contracts report found via Reporting > Reports > Staff (tab)
- Filter the QTS column for 'No' by typing in the white box under the header then press enter on your keyboard
- Have a look through the list and check if any staff members should have QTS that currently don't.
